Yup, although if you ask Mika, you'll get an entirely different story -- a rant on Corey's now-patented soft cut-break:

"Immonen started what he called the “snowball effect” in late October at the 2008 U.S. Open, the scene of his most nightmarish professional defeat, back in 2001, when Corey Deuel soft-breaked him into oblivion, streaking, from the get-go, to 11 straight games in the final. The memory of that match is still “disturbing” to Immonen."

[...]

"Corey put on ‘The Soft Break Show.’ He’d lag the ball to the rack and the wing ball kept going in and the 1 ball kept ending up by the side pocket. It’s not the way 9-ball should be played."
